24/female. taking wellbutrin (bupropion) xl 150 mg concerta 36 mg in the morning and trazodone 50 - 100 mg at bed. could any of these meds cause extreme retching?

Extreme retching is: An uncommon side effect to these medications. It is important to consult your prescriber and determine if the timing of the retching coincides with taking one of the medications or may be from another cause. Best wishes in resolving the problem.
